Christian Democratic Leaders’ Roundtable in Brussels

The Christian Democratic Institute recently hosted two events in Brussels featuring Prof. Dr. Christiaan Alting von Geusau, President of the International Catholic Legislators’ Network. The discussions offered a timely opportunity to reflect on key questions shaping international political dynamics.

Both events brought together participants from various professional and academic backgrounds to explore pressing global issues. Central topics included the evolving role of the United States in world affairs, especially in light of shifting geopolitical alliances, and the potential influence of the next Pope on global leadership and the moral dimensions of international decision-making.

Prof. Dr. Alting von Geusau provided thoughtful insights into the broader trends of international relations and the challenges faced by global institutions. His remarks encouraged dialogue on the intersection of faith, politics, and diplomacy in a time of uncertainty.

The events reflect the Institute’s commitment to fostering constructive conversations on international political developments and the role of values-based leadership in today’s world.
